Grid Integration Issues

Cost, Reliability & Efficiency of Grid Interface


Grid Congestion, Weak Grids
Variability of Renewable Production
Bidirectional Power Flow in Distribution Networks,
Localized Voltage Stability Problems
Possible Solutions
Enhance Transmission Lines, Active Grid Control
Energy Storage: Large Scale (e.g. Pumped Hydro) for
Balance of Power; Fast Acting Storage for Stability
Load Management and Demand Response

Partition System into a Source and a Load Subsystem


Determine Source Subsystem Output Impedance (Zs) and Load
Subsystem Input Impedance (Zl)
System is Stability if Zs/Zl Meets Nyquist Stability Criterion

A Simulated Distribution Grid with


Programmable Voltage, Frequency Variation, Harmonics
Programmable Grid Impedance

Various Distributed Generation Sources & Loads
